Waimanalo CDP, Hawaii Citizen Voting-age Population By Race and Ethnicity in 2011 (ACS-5Yrs)
Based on the US Census Bureau's special tabulation from the ACS 5-year estimates, in 2011, the citizen voting-age population for Waimanalo CDP, Hawaii was 3.89K. The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races ethnicity group had the highest citizen voting-age population (1.09K) and constituted 28.16% of the total.
The Non-Hispanic Asian Alone ethnicity group had the second highest citizen voting-age population (885) and constituted 22.78% of the total. The Non-Hispanic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one ethnicity group had the third highest (870), constituting 22.39% of the total citizen voting-age population.

| Ethnicity | Voting-age Population | % of Voting-age Pop. |
|---|---|---|
|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races | 1094 | 28.16 |
| Non-Hispanic Asian Alone | 885 | 22.78 |
| Non-Hispanic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one | 870 | 22.39 |
| Non-Hispanic White Alone | 610 | 15.70 |
| Hispanic or Latino of All Races | 360 | 9.27 |
|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one | 65 | 1.67 |
